DBA Data[Home] [Help]

APPS.PO_R12_CAT_UPG_VAL_PVT dependencies on PO_LINES_INTERFACE

Line 2753: -- p_table_name => 'PO_LINES_INTERFACE',

2749: --PO_R12_CAT_UPG_UTL.add_fatal_error(
2750: -- p_interface_header_id => l_interface_header_ids(i),
2751: -- p_interface_line_id => l_interface_line_ids(i),
2752: -- p_error_message_name => 'PO_PDOI_INVALID_ITEM_ID',
2753: -- p_table_name => 'PO_LINES_INTERFACE',
2754: -- p_column_name => 'ITEM_ID',
2755: -- p_column_value => l_item_id_list(i),
2756: -- p_token1_name => 'VALUE',
2757: -- p_token1_value => l_item_id_list(i)

Line 2884: -- p_table_name => 'PO_LINES_INTERFACE',

2880: --PO_R12_CAT_UPG_UTL.add_fatal_error(
2881: -- p_interface_header_id => l_interface_header_ids(i),
2882: -- p_interface_line_id => l_interface_line_ids(i),
2883: -- p_error_message_name => 'PO_PDOI_DIFF_ITEM_DESC',
2884: -- p_table_name => 'PO_LINES_INTERFACE',
2885: -- p_column_name => 'ITEM_DESCRIPTION',
2886: -- p_column_value => l_item_description_list(i)
2887: -- );
2888: END LOOP;

Line 2987: p_table_name => 'PO_LINES_INTERFACE',

2983: PO_R12_CAT_UPG_UTL.add_fatal_error(
2984: p_interface_header_id => p_lines_rec.interface_header_id(i),
2985: p_interface_line_id => p_lines_rec.interface_line_id(i),
2986: p_error_message_name => 'ICX_CAT_UOM_CODE_REQD',
2987: p_table_name => 'PO_LINES_INTERFACE',
2988: p_column_name => 'UOM_CODE',
2989: p_column_value => p_lines_rec.uom_code(i)
2990: );
2991: END IF;

Line 3062: p_table_name => 'PO_LINES_INTERFACE',

3058: PO_R12_CAT_UPG_UTL.add_fatal_error(
3059: p_interface_header_id => p_lines_rec.interface_header_id(i),
3060: p_interface_line_id => p_lines_rec.interface_line_id(i),
3061: p_error_message_name => 'ICX_CAT_INVALID_UOM_CODE',
3062: p_table_name => 'PO_LINES_INTERFACE',
3063: p_column_name => 'UOM_CODE',
3064: p_column_value => p_lines_rec.uom_code(i),
3065: p_token1_name => 'VALUE',
3066: p_token1_value => p_lines_rec.uom_code(i)

Line 3139: p_table_name => 'PO_LINES_INTERFACE',

3135: p_interface_header_id => l_interface_header_ids(i),
3136: p_interface_line_id => l_interface_line_ids(i),
3137: --p_error_message_name => 'PO_PDOI_INVALID_UOM_CODE',
3138: p_error_message_name => 'ICX_CAT_INVALID_UOM_CODE',
3139: p_table_name => 'PO_LINES_INTERFACE',
3140: p_column_name => 'UOM_CODE',
3141: p_column_value => l_uom_code_list(i),
3142: p_token1_name => 'VALUE',
3143: p_token1_value => l_uom_code_list(i)

Line 3227: -- p_table_name => 'PO_LINES_INTERFACE',

3223: --PO_R12_CAT_UPG_UTL.add_fatal_error(
3224: -- p_interface_header_id => p_lines_rec.interface_header_id(i),
3225: -- p_interface_line_id => p_lines_rec.interface_line_id(i),
3226: -- p_error_message_name => 'PO_COLUMN_NOT_NULL',
3227: -- p_table_name => 'PO_LINES_INTERFACE',
3228: -- p_column_name => 'ITEM_REVISION',
3229: -- p_column_value => p_lines_rec.item_revision(i)
3230: -- );
3231: END IF;

Line 3297: -- p_table_name => 'PO_LINES_INTERFACE',

3293: --PO_R12_CAT_UPG_UTL.add_fatal_error(
3294: -- p_interface_header_id => l_interface_header_ids(i),
3295: -- p_interface_line_id => l_interface_line_ids(i),
3296: -- p_error_message_name => 'PO_PDOI_ITEM_RELATED_INFO',
3297: -- p_table_name => 'PO_LINES_INTERFACE',
3298: -- p_column_name => 'ITEM_REVISION',
3299: -- p_column_value => l_item_revision_list(i),
3300: -- p_token1_name => 'COLUMN_NAME',
3301: -- p_token1_value => 'ITEM_REVISION',

Line 3458: p_table_name => 'PO_LINES_INTERFACE',

3454: PO_R12_CAT_UPG_UTL.add_fatal_error(
3455: p_interface_header_id => p_interface_header_id,
3456: p_interface_line_id => p_interface_line_id,
3457: p_error_message_name => 'ICX_CAT_SHOP_CATEG_REQD',
3458: p_table_name => 'PO_LINES_INTERFACE',
3459: p_column_name => 'IP_CATEGORY_ID',
3460: p_column_value => p_ip_category_id
3461: );
3462: END IF;

Line 3585: p_table_name => 'PO_LINES_INTERFACE',

3581: p_interface_header_id => p_lines_rec.interface_header_id(i),
3582: p_interface_line_id => p_lines_rec.interface_line_id(i),
3583: --p_error_message_name => 'PO_COLUMN_IS_NULL',
3584: p_error_message_name => 'ICX_CAT_CATEGORY_REQD',
3585: p_table_name => 'PO_LINES_INTERFACE',
3586: p_column_name => 'CATEGORY',
3587: p_column_value => l_ip_category_name, -- ECO bug 5584556
3588: p_token1_name => 'PO_CATEGORY_ID',
3589: p_token1_value => p_lines_rec.category(i), -- debug only, this is NULL here

Line 3691: p_table_name => 'PO_LINES_INTERFACE',

3687: p_interface_header_id => l_interface_header_ids(i),
3688: p_interface_line_id => l_interface_line_ids(i),
3689: --p_error_message_name => 'PO_PDOI_ITEM_RELATED_INFO',
3690: p_error_message_name => 'ICX_CAT_INVALID_CATEGORY',
3691: p_table_name => 'PO_LINES_INTERFACE',
3692: p_column_name => 'CATEGORY_ID',
3693: p_column_value => l_category_name, -- ECO bug 5584556
3694: p_token1_name => 'VALUE',
3695: p_token1_value => l_category_id_list(i),

Line 3779: p_table_name => 'PO_LINES_INTERFACE',

3775: p_interface_header_id => l_interface_header_ids(i),
3776: p_interface_line_id => l_interface_line_ids(i),
3777: --p_error_message_name => 'PO_PDOI_INVALID_CATEGORY_ID',
3778: p_error_message_name => 'ICX_CAT_INVALID_CATEGORY',
3779: p_table_name => 'PO_LINES_INTERFACE',
3780: p_column_name => 'CATEGORY_ID',
3781: p_column_value => l_category_name, -- ECO bug 5584556
3782: p_token1_name => 'VALUE',
3783: p_token1_value => l_category_id_list(i)

Line 3866: p_table_name => 'PO_LINES_INTERFACE',

3862: p_interface_header_id => l_interface_header_ids(i),
3863: p_interface_line_id => l_interface_line_ids(i),
3864: --p_error_message_name => 'PO_PDOI_INVALID_CATEGORY_ID',
3865: p_error_message_name => 'ICX_CAT_INVALID_CATEGORY',
3866: p_table_name => 'PO_LINES_INTERFACE',
3867: p_column_name => 'CATEGORY_ID',
3868: p_column_value => l_category_name, -- ECO bug 5584556
3869: p_token1_name => 'VALUE',
3870: p_token1_value => l_category_id_list(i)

Line 3954: p_table_name => 'PO_LINES_INTERFACE',

3950: p_interface_header_id => p_lines_rec.interface_header_id(i),
3951: p_interface_line_id => p_lines_rec.interface_line_id(i),
3952: --p_error_message_name => 'PO_PDOI_LT_ZERO',
3953: p_error_message_name => 'ICX_CAT_INVALID_PRICE',
3954: p_table_name => 'PO_LINES_INTERFACE',
3955: p_column_name => 'UNIT_PRICE',
3956: p_column_value => p_lines_rec.unit_price(i),
3957: p_token1_name => 'COLUMN_NAME',
3958: p_token1_value => 'UNIT_PRICE',

Line 4156: UPDATE PO_LINES_INTERFACE POLI

4152:
4153: -- SQL What: validate create action at line level
4154: -- SQL Why : To find incorrect action
4155: -- SQL Join: processing_id, action, interface_header_id
4156: UPDATE PO_LINES_INTERFACE POLI
4157: SET POLI.processing_id = -POLI.processing_id,
4158: POLI.process_code = PO_R12_CAT_UPG_PVT.g_PROCESS_CODE_REJECTED
4159: WHERE POLI.processing_id = PO_R12_CAT_UPG_PVT.g_processing_id
4160: AND POLI.action = 'ORIGINAL'

Line 4174: p_table_name => 'PO_LINES_INTERFACE',

4170: PO_R12_CAT_UPG_UTL.add_fatal_error(
4171: p_interface_header_id => l_err_header_ids(i),
4172: p_interface_line_id => l_err_line_ids(i),
4173: p_error_message_name => 'PO_CAT_UPG_ORIG_NOT_ALLOWED',
4174: p_table_name => 'PO_LINES_INTERFACE',
4175: p_column_name => 'ACTION'
4176: );
4177: END LOOP;
4178:

Line 4272: FROM PO_LINES_INTERFACE POLI

4268: WHERE POAI.processing_id = PO_R12_CAT_UPG_PVT.g_processing_id
4269: AND POAI.action = PO_R12_CAT_UPG_PVT.g_action_attr_create
4270: AND (EXISTS
4271: (SELECT 'Invalid relationship with Line Level'
4272: FROM PO_LINES_INTERFACE POLI
4273: WHERE POLI.interface_line_id = POAI.interface_line_id
4274: AND ( -- Attribute Row for GBPA must have appr action at line level
4275: (POAI.req_template_name = g_NOT_REQUIRED_REQ_TEMPLATE AND
4276: POAI.req_template_line_num = g_NOT_REQUIRED_ID AND

Line 4325: FROM PO_LINES_INTERFACE POLI

4321: WHERE POAI.processing_id = PO_R12_CAT_UPG_PVT.g_processing_id
4322: AND POAI.action = PO_R12_CAT_UPG_PVT.g_action_attr_create
4323: AND (EXISTS
4324: (SELECT 'Invalid relationship with Line Level'
4325: FROM PO_LINES_INTERFACE POLI
4326: WHERE POLI.interface_line_id = POAI.interface_line_id
4327: AND ( -- Attribute Row for ReqTemplate must have action as REQTEMPALTE at line level
4328: ((POAI.req_template_name <> g_NOT_REQUIRED_REQ_TEMPLATE OR
4329: POAI.req_template_line_num <> g_NOT_REQUIRED_ID) AND

Line 4511: FROM PO_LINES_INTERFACE POLI

4507: )
4508: OR
4509: (EXISTS
4510: (SELECT 'Invalid relationship with Line Level'
4511: FROM PO_LINES_INTERFACE POLI
4512: WHERE POLI.interface_line_id = POATI.interface_line_id
4513: AND ( -- Attribute Row for GBPA must have appr action at line level
4514: (POATI.req_template_name = g_NOT_REQUIRED_REQ_TEMPLATE AND
4515: POATI.req_template_line_num = g_NOT_REQUIRED_ID AND

Line 4681: UPDATE PO_LINES_INTERFACE POLI

4677:
4678: -- SQL What: validate ADD action at line level
4679: -- SQL Why : To find incorrect action
4680: -- SQL Join: processing_id, action, po_header_id
4681: UPDATE PO_LINES_INTERFACE POLI
4682: SET POLI.processing_id = -POLI.processing_id,
4683: POLI.process_code = PO_R12_CAT_UPG_PVT.g_PROCESS_CODE_REJECTED
4684: WHERE POLI.processing_id = PO_R12_CAT_UPG_PVT.g_processing_id
4685: AND POLI.action = PO_R12_CAT_UPG_PVT.g_action_line_create -- ADD

Line 4705: p_table_name => 'PO_LINES_INTERFACE',

4701: PO_R12_CAT_UPG_UTL.add_fatal_error(
4702: p_interface_header_id => l_err_header_ids(i),
4703: p_interface_line_id => l_err_line_ids(i),
4704: p_error_message_name => 'PO_CAT_UPG_INVALID_HEADER_ID',
4705: p_table_name => 'PO_LINES_INTERFACE',
4706: p_column_name => 'PO_HEADER_ID'
4707: );
4708: END LOOP;
4709:

Line 4919: UPDATE PO_LINES_INTERFACE POLI

4915:
4916: -- SQL What: validate update action at Line level
4917: -- SQL Why : To find incorrect action
4918: -- SQL Join: processing_id, action, po_line_id
4919: UPDATE PO_LINES_INTERFACE POLI
4920: SET POLI.processing_id = -POLI.processing_id,
4921: POLI.process_code = PO_R12_CAT_UPG_PVT.g_PROCESS_CODE_REJECTED
4922: WHERE POLI.processing_id = PO_R12_CAT_UPG_PVT.g_processing_id
4923: AND POLI.action = 'UPDATE'

Line 4942: p_table_name => 'po_lines_interface',

4938: PO_R12_CAT_UPG_UTL.add_fatal_error(
4939: p_interface_header_id => l_err_header_ids(i),
4940: p_interface_line_id => l_err_line_ids(i),
4941: p_error_message_name => 'PO_CAT_UPG_INVALID_LINE_ID',
4942: p_table_name => 'po_lines_interface',
4943: p_column_name => 'PO_LINE_ID'
4944: );
4945: END LOOP;
4946:

Line 5258: UPDATE PO_LINES_INTERFACE POLI

5254:
5255: -- SQL What: validate delete action at line level
5256: -- SQL Why : To find incorrect action
5257: -- SQL Join: processing_id, action, po_line_id
5258: UPDATE PO_LINES_INTERFACE POLI
5259: SET POLI.processing_id = -POLI.processing_id,
5260: POLI.process_code = PO_R12_CAT_UPG_PVT.g_PROCESS_CODE_REJECTED
5261: WHERE POLI.processing_id = PO_R12_CAT_UPG_PVT.g_processing_id
5262: AND POLI.action = 'DELETE'

Line 5282: p_table_name => 'po_lines_interface',

5278: PO_R12_CAT_UPG_UTL.add_fatal_error(
5279: p_interface_header_id => l_err_header_ids(i),
5280: p_interface_line_id => l_err_line_ids(i),
5281: p_error_message_name => 'PO_CAT_UPG_INVALID_LINE_ID',
5282: p_table_name => 'po_lines_interface',
5283: p_column_name => 'PO_LINE_ID'
5284: );
5285: END LOOP;
5286: